Radiometer Data at Squaw Butte Site https://data.eol.ucar.edu/dataset/534.014 Summary This dataset contains the Radiometrics MP-Series microwave profiling radiometer data from the Squaw Butte Site during the SNOWIE (Seeded and Natural Orographic Wintertime Clouds: The Idaho Experiment) project. The Radiometrics MP-Series microwave profilers deliver continuous temperature, humidity, and liquid soundings to 10-km height. The MP-3000 uses 21 K-band channels and 14 V-band channels and provides all-weather rain effect mitigation and multiple elevation scans. Data were collected from 06 October 2016 to 05 March 2017. These data are in comma separated value text files. Please refer to the readme for more information.
